American figure skaters Ilia Malinin, Jason Brown, and Camden Pulkinen successfully secured their spots in the men's free skate final following a dominant performance during the short program qualifying round at the Winter Olympics in Milan, Italy, on Wednesday. Led by the world-renowned 'Quad God' Ilia Malinin, the U.S. trio outperformed a competitive field of nearly 30 international skaters to ensure a clean sweep for the American team heading into the medal round. The advancement of all three athletes highlights the current depth of the United States men’s program as they seek to secure podium positions in one of the most prestigious events of the Winter Games. All three U.S. men's figure skaters are moving on to the free skate final after Wednesday's qualifying round at the Winter Olympics. The event saw the "Quad God" Ilia Malinin leading the pack of nearly 30 skaters. CBS News' Kelly O'Grady has more from Milan, Italy.
